Insulin Resistance: Why Strength Training Improves Sensitivity

Confident middle aged woman lifting dumbbells indoors, the strength training that improves insulin resistance

Insulin resistance is the state in which cells respond less readily to insulin, so the pancreas has to release more of it to keep blood glucose in range. Blood sugar readings can stay normal for years while insulin levels climb quietly in the background. Strength training helps more than almost anything else because muscle is where glucose goes after a meal, and building and using muscle gives it somewhere to go.

What is insulin resistance, and what causes it?

The condition describes cells that have become less responsive to insulin's signal to take glucose out of the bloodstream. The pancreas compensates by producing more insulin, and for a long time that compensation works well enough that a standard blood sugar reading looks unremarkable. The underlying change is in the amount of insulin required, not yet in the glucose result.

The drivers are well established and mostly cumulative: excess body fat, particularly around the middle, long periods of physical inactivity, poor sleep, and a diet high in refined carbohydrates and low in fibre. Genetics set the starting point and family history matters, but the modifiable factors carry most of the practical weight, which is the encouraging part.

Left unaddressed, the compensation eventually falters and glucose starts to rise, which is the path towards type 2 diabetes that the NHS describes. Diabetes UK is clear that this progression is not inevitable, and the earlier stage is precisely where the interventions in this article have the most room to work.

Why normal blood sugar can be misleading

For years the pancreas can mask the problem by simply producing more insulin. A normal glucose result tells you the compensation is still working. It does not tell you how hard your body is working to achieve it, which is why waist measurement, blood pressure and family history all belong in the same conversation.

Why does strength training improve insulin resistance so effectively?

Strength training works on the demand side of the equation. Skeletal muscle is the principal destination for glucose after a meal, so the total amount of muscle tissue you carry sets the size of that destination. Resistance work increases muscle mass over months and, more immediately, empties muscle glycogen stores, which makes muscle eager to take up glucose in the hours after a session.

Two effects therefore run on different timescales. The acute effect appears after a single session and lasts roughly a day or two, which is the argument for training regularly rather than heavily. The structural effect accumulates over months as muscle is added. Together they explain why strength training complements walking and cardio rather than competing with them.

The NHS reflects this in its guidance by listing strengthening activities as a separate requirement, not as an optional extra: adults should do strengthening activities that work all the major muscle groups, meaning legs, hips, back, abdomen, chest, shoulders and arms, on at least 2 days a week.

How much exercise does it actually take?

The NHS target for adults aged 19 to 64 is at least 150 minutes of moderate intensity activity a week or 75 minutes of vigorous intensity activity, plus strengthening work on at least 2 days, ideally spread across 4 to 5 days rather than compressed into one. It also advises reducing time spent sitting and breaking up long periods of not moving.

That last instruction is the one most people underrate. Long uninterrupted sitting worsens glucose handling independently of whether you hit the weekly total, so a person who trains hard for an hour and then sits for ten is not in the same position as someone who moves in smaller amounts throughout the day. Breaking up sitting is a separate lever, not a softer version of exercise.

Speak to your GP first if you have not exercised for some time or have existing health conditions, which is exactly what the NHS guidance itself advises. Starting below the target and building is far more effective than starting at the target and stopping in a fortnight.

What to do How often Why it helps
Strength training, all major muscle groups At least 2 days a week Builds the tissue that stores glucose and empties muscle glycogen
Moderate activity such as brisk walking 150 minutes a week, spread over 4 to 5 days Improves how readily muscle takes up glucose
Walk after your largest meal 10 to 15 minutes, daily Blunts the post meal glucose rise immediately
Break up long periods of sitting Every 30 to 60 minutes Sitting worsens glucose handling independently of training
Sleep 7 to 9 hours Nightly Short sleep measurably worsens insulin sensitivity

What role does diet play in insulin resistance?

Diet changes how much glucose arrives and how quickly, which is the supply side of the same equation exercise works on from the demand side. The most useful shifts are unglamorous: more fibre, more protein, fewer refined carbohydrates, and fewer sugary drinks. None of them require a named diet or a paid plan.

The NHS Eatwell Guide provides the shape without any of the marketing. Fruit and vegetables should make up just over a third of what you eat, starchy foods just over another third with higher fibre or wholegrain versions chosen where possible, and protein foods filling much of the rest. Fruit juice and smoothies should be limited to a combined 150ml a day, which is the fastest single reduction in liquid sugar most people can make.

Meal order and composition help too, at no cost. Eating protein and vegetables before the carbohydrate portion of a meal lowers the glucose peak that follows, and pairing carbohydrate with protein, fat or fibre does the same. These are adjustments to how you eat rather than restrictions on what you eat, which is a large part of why they last.

How is insulin resistance linked to hair thinning and PCOS?

The connection runs through androgens rather than through glucose directly. Persistently high insulin stimulates the ovaries to produce more androgens and simultaneously lowers sex hormone binding globulin, the protein that keeps androgens inactive in the blood. The result is more free androgen circulating, acting on scalp follicles that are genetically sensitive to it.

That is the mechanism behind the hair changes seen in polycystic ovary syndrome, which the NHS now refers to as polyendocrine metabolic ovarian syndrome. Hair thins at the parting and crown in the female pattern while unwanted hair may increase on the face and body, because scalp and body follicles respond to androgens in opposite directions. Three different problems get confused here and they are worth separating. Hair loss means follicles miniaturising over years, which is what androgens drive. Hair shedding means the growth cycle reacting to a trigger such as rapid weight loss, appearing two to three months later and then recovering. Hair breakage means the fibre snapping from heat or handling, which has no metabolic component at all. Improving insulin sensitivity can influence the first, may prevent the second, and does nothing for the third.

How do you know whether you have insulin resistance?

There is no routine NHS test for the condition itself, so it is usually inferred from a cluster of findings rather than confirmed by a single number. A GP will typically look at HbA1c, which reflects average blood glucose over roughly three months, together with blood pressure, cholesterol, waist measurement and family history. Some physical signs point towards it. Darkened, velvety patches of skin in the neck folds, armpits or groin, known as acanthosis nigricans, are strongly associated with high circulating insulin. Persistent fatigue after meals, difficulty losing weight around the middle, and irregular periods in women are all worth mentioning at the same appointment rather than in isolation.

Ask your GP for a general review rather than requesting a specific test. NHS blood tests are free, and a clinician looking at the whole picture will interpret them far better than any online calculator.

What does a realistic starting plan look like?

A realistic plan is small enough that you will still be doing it in three months, because insulin sensitivity responds to consistency rather than intensity. Two short strength sessions a week covering the major muscle groups, a ten to fifteen minute walk after your largest meal, and one dietary change held steady will outperform an ambitious programme abandoned in February.

Pick the dietary change that costs you least. For many people that is cutting sugary drinks, since liquid sugar arrives fast and satisfies little. For others it is adding protein to breakfast, which tends to flatten both the glucose curve and mid morning snacking. One change, held, beats five changes attempted.

Measure the right things. Waist measurement, how weights feel, energy after meals and sleep quality all shift before the scales do, and judging a metabolic intervention purely by weight is the most common reason people quit something that is already working.

Frequently asked questions

What is insulin resistance in plain English?

Insulin resistance means your cells respond less readily to insulin, so the pancreas releases more of it to move the same amount of glucose out of the blood. Blood sugar can look normal for years while insulin levels quietly climb, which is why the condition is so often missed early.

Why is strength training singled out for this condition?

Skeletal muscle is the body's main destination for glucose after a meal, so the amount of muscle you carry and how often you use it changes how much glucose has somewhere to go. Strength training addresses both, which is why it complements rather than duplicates walking and cardio.

How much exercise does the NHS actually recommend?

The NHS advises strengthening activities working all the major muscle groups on at least 2 days a week, plus at least 150 minutes of moderate intensity activity or 75 minutes of vigorous activity weekly, spread over 4 to 5 days. It also advises reducing time spent sitting.

Can you improve insulin sensitivity without losing weight?

Yes. Exercise improves how readily muscle takes up glucose independently of any change on the scales, and improvements can appear within weeks. Weight loss adds to the effect, but treating the scales as the only measure of progress makes people quit something that is already working.

Does walking after meals genuinely help?

Short walks after eating blunt the rise in blood glucose that follows a meal, and the effect is most useful after the largest meal of the day. Ten to fifteen minutes is enough to matter. It is one of the few interventions that is free, immediate and requires no equipment.

Is insulin resistance the same as type 2 diabetes?

No. It is a state that can persist for years while blood glucose remains within range. Type 2 diabetes is diagnosed when glucose passes defined thresholds. The distinction matters because the earlier stage is where lifestyle change has the most room to work.

How does poor insulin sensitivity affect hair?

The link runs mainly through androgens. Higher circulating insulin encourages the ovaries to produce more androgens and lowers the protein that binds them, leaving more free androgen to act on susceptible scalp follicles. That is why hair thinning at the parting is a common feature of polycystic ovary syndrome.

Which test should I ask my GP about?

There is no routine NHS test for it. In practice a GP looks at HbA1c, which reflects average blood glucose over about three months, alongside blood pressure, cholesterol and waist measurement. Ask for a review rather than a specific test and let them decide what fits.
